2020-2021 SCHOOL YEAR FULL-DAY PROGRAM

Nextide Academy's After-School Program is now a Full-Day Program for the upcoming school year. Since LCPS has announced 100% distance learning as of July 21st, 2020, we have decided to keep our doors open from 7:45 a.m. to 6:00 p.m.

The full-time program will have emphasis on learning simulating a school structure with four focused learning sessions per day adapting to the LCPS Curriculum. Our school simulation sessions will end at 3 PM and we will resume our after-school activities.

After-school Activities: 3:00 p.m - 6:00 p.m.

We will limit the student enrollment to half of our building capacit to practice social distancing. As we tread through this pandemic, we plan to use our 5000 sq ft facility with enough social distancing in place for our students.


Due to the limited enrollment, students who will be enrolling for an entire week of camp will get priority.

Why STEM?

Nearly 80% of future careers will require awareness of and facility with STEM
Only 43% of graduating seniors are ready for college math and 27% are ready for college science
Just 32% of U.S. college undergraduates are graduating with a bachelor's degree in science or engineering
